Gender-Smart Entrepreneurship Education & Training Plus Report

The COVID-19 pandemic has forced small business support organizations and educational institutions across the globe to re-think how they deliver entrepreneurship education and training. The unprecedented transition to online delivery methods presents an opportunity to create more inclusive entrepreneurship courses, programs and small business support services.

Telfer School of Management, University of Ottawa’s ‘Gender-Smart Entrepreneurship Education & Training Plus’ (GEET+) is a purpose-built framework and scorecard that enables educators and trainers to adopt inclusive perspectives and content within entrepreneurship, small business management and new venture courses and programs. 

Authored by Dr. Barbara Orser and Dr. Catherine Elliott, GEET+ translates academic research and evidence-based insights into practical applications to support the development of inclusive entrepreneurship education and training. Telfer faculty are also collaborating with global knowledge partners, such as Women’s Economic Initiative, to adopt insights from this ground-breaking report and strengthen the design and delivery of entrepreneurship courses and programs.
